Output ecfcba99d9350319563caba915461335af71d9c34afa608a0ef1cd0299ec917d:1

value
1082694
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b203ed3e47f631e40bafc13bbd6e95217c3bd493 OP_EQUALVERIFY OP_CHECKSIG
address
1HEFyyqQryj5xJZTatxBDb9fjWAeqFLo1U
transaction
ecfcba99d9350319563caba915461335af71d9c34afa608a0ef1cd0299ec917d
spent
true